JEFFERSON COUNTY COMMUNITY SERVICES | JEFFERSON COUNTY GOVERNMENT
Develop a program of local mental hygiene services for the county.
Provide fiscal oversight of the state and local monies used in the provision of mental hygiene services. Oversee the preschool program for children with disabilities for Jefferson County. Ensure coordination, cooperation, and integration among local providers of mental hygiene services. Direct and administer the development of a local annual comprehensive plan for all services for mentally disabled residents of the county which shall be submitted to the department and used in part to formulate a statewide comprehensive plan for services. Administer the Early Intervention program for infants and toddlers with disabilities or delays for Jefferson County.
